What is a pastry apprentice?

Pastry apprentices are entry-level culinary workers who are learning the art and techniques of baking and pastry making under the supervision of experienced pastry chefs. They assist with preparing doughs, batters, fillings, and decorating baked goods such as breads, cakes, and pastries. The apprenticeship allows them to gain hands-on experience, develop professional skills, and understand kitchen operations. Over time, pastry apprentices can advance to higher positions as they gain proficiency in the craft.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a pastry apprentice?

To thrive as a Pastry Apprentice, you need a foundational understanding of baking techniques, attention to detail, and a willingness to learn, often supported by a high school diploma or enrollment in a culinary program. Familiarity with commercial kitchen equipment, food safety standards, and recipe management systems is typically required. Creativity, strong time management, and the ability to take direction are essential soft skills for excelling in this role. These skills are important because they ensure the apprentice can produce consistent, high-quality pastries while contributing effectively to a busy kitchen environment.

What are some common challenges faced by a pastry apprentice, and how can they be overcome?

Pastry Apprentices often encounter challenges such as mastering time management during high-volume production and learning to work efficiently under pressure. Adapting to the precision required in pastry recipes and presentation can also be demanding, as consistency is crucial in professional kitchens. To overcome these hurdles, apprentices should be proactive in seeking feedback from mentors, practice meticulous organization, and gradually build speed while maintaining quality. Developing strong communication skills with the pastry team also helps ensure smooth workflow during busy periods.

What is the difference between Pastry Apprentice vs Pastry Cook?

AspectPastry ApprenticePastry Cook
CredentialsBasic culinary training, often in pastry artsFormal culinary education or equivalent experience
Work EnvironmentTraining kitchens, bakeries, pastry shopsBakery kitchens, restaurants, hotels
Job RoleAssists in pastry preparation, learns techniquesPrepares and bakes pastries, manages pastry station

In summary, a Pastry Apprentice is in training, focusing on learning pastry techniques under supervision, while a Pastry Cook is a more experienced role responsible for preparing pastries independently in professional kitchens.
